Part Overview
The JMAP-26XM is a general purpose relay manufactured by TE Connectivity Aerospace, Defense and Marine. This DPDT (2 Form C) relay operates at 26.5VDC coil voltage with a 1 A contact rating and is designed for through-hole mounting applications. The part is currently active in production with 899 pieces in stock.
Substitute parts are necessary when the JMAP-26XM becomes unavailable, when design requirements mandate specific compliance certifications, or when alternative series options are required for supply chain continuity. The substitute parts listed maintain electrical and mechanical compatibility while offering variations in military qualification status and RoHS compliance.

Key Parameters
| Parameter | Value |
|---|---|
| Coil Voltage | 26.5VDC |
| Contact Form | DPDT (2 Form C) |
| Contact Rating (Current) | 1 A |
| Switching Voltage | 115VAC, 28VDC - Max |
| Mounting Type | Through Hole |
| Termination Style | PC Pin |
| Seal Rating | Sealed - Hermetically |
| Operating Temperature Range | -65°C ~ 125°C |
| Contact Material | Silver Palladium (AgPd), Gold (Au) |
| Coil Type | Non Latching |
| Must Operate Voltage | 14.2 VDC |
| Must Release Voltage | 1.37 VDC |
| Operate Time | 2 ms |
| Release Time | 1.5 ms |

Engineering Selection Recommendations
JMAC-26XM: This substitute is electrically and mechanically equivalent to the JMAP-26XM. It carries MIL-R-39016/9 military qualification and is ROHS3 compliant. This part is suitable for applications requiring military-grade certification and RoHS compliance. Product status is active with 927 pieces in inventory.
JMAC-26XP: This substitute is electrically and mechanically equivalent to the JMAP-26XM. It carries MIL-R-39016/9 military qualification but is RoHS non-compliant. This part is suitable for applications requiring military-grade certification without RoHS compliance constraints. Product status is active with 706 pieces in inventory.
JMAW-26XL: This substitute is electrically and mechanically equivalent to the JMAP-26XM. It carries MIL-R-39016/9 military qualification and is ROHS3 compliant. This part is suitable for applications requiring military-grade certification and RoHS compliance. Product status is active with 659 pieces in inventory.
PRMAC-26XS: This substitute is electrically and mechanically equivalent to the JMAP-26XM. It is RoHS non-compliant and carries no military qualification. Product status is discontinued at DiGi Electronics with 667 pieces in inventory. This part is suitable only for legacy system support or when existing inventory must be maintained.
PRMAC-26Y: This substitute is electrically and mechanically equivalent to the JMAP-26XM. It is RoHS non-compliant and carries no military qualification. Product status is discontinued at DiGi Electronics with 850 pieces in inventory. This part is suitable only for legacy system support or when existing inventory must be maintained.
Frequently Asked Questions (FAQ)
Q: Can JMAC-26XM be used as a direct replacement for JMAP-26XM?
A: Yes. The JMAC-26XM maintains complete electrical and mechanical equivalence with the JMAP-26XM across all critical parameters including coil voltage, contact form, contact rating, switching voltage, operating temperature range, and timing specifications. The primary difference is that JMAC-26XM carries MIL-R-39016/9 military qualification and is ROHS3 compliant.
Q: What is the difference between JMAC-26XM and JMAC-26XP?
A: Both parts are electrically and mechanically equivalent and carry MIL-R-39016/9 military qualification. The difference is in RoHS compliance: JMAC-26XM is ROHS3 compliant while JMAC-26XP is RoHS non-compliant. Selection depends on whether RoHS compliance is required for the application.
Q: Why are PRMAC-26XS and PRMAC-26Y listed as discontinued?
A: Both PRMAC series parts are discontinued at DiGi Electronics. They remain electrically and mechanically equivalent to the JMAP-26XM but lack military qualification and RoHS compliance. These parts should be used only for legacy system maintenance or when existing inventory must be consumed.
Q: Are all substitute parts suitable for aerospace and defense applications?
A: The JMAC-26XM, JMAC-26XP, and JMAW-26XL carry MIL-R-39016/9 military qualification and are suitable for aerospace and defense applications. The PRMAC-26XS and PRMAC-26Y do not carry military qualification and are not recommended for new aerospace and defense designs.
Q: What is the difference between JMAW-26XL and JMAC-26XM?
A: Both parts are electrically and mechanically equivalent and carry MIL-R-39016/9 military qualification with ROHS3 compliance. The difference is in the base product series: JMAW-26XL uses the JMAW-26 base product number while JMAC-26XM uses the JMAC base product number. Both are suitable for equivalent applications.
Q: Can I use a PRMAC series relay in a new design?
A: PRMAC-26XS and PRMAC-26Y are discontinued at DiGi Electronics and lack military qualification. These parts are not suitable for new designs. Use JMAC-26XM, JMAC-26XP, or JMAW-26XL for new applications.
Q: Are all substitute parts hermetically sealed?
A: Yes. All substitute parts listed maintain the sealed hermetically rating, which is identical to the JMAP-26XM. This ensures equivalent environmental protection across all substitute options.
Q: What is the coil resistance specification for each part?
A: The JMAP-26XM and PRMAC series parts specify coil resistance as 1.56 kOhms. The JMAC-26XM, JMAC-26XP, and JMAW-26XL specify coil resistance as 1560 Ohms. These values are electrically equivalent (1.56 kOhms = 1560 Ohms) and represent the same component characteristic.
